STATUS LED - (Behind front panel lens.) One multi-color LED. This LED will illuminate red/blue and flash in different modes to indicate changes in the SOUNDSOLE 2.1operational status. SOLID RED - OFF (Standby). Power cord is connected and AC switch is turned ON, but the SOUNDSOLE 2.1 is OFF. SOLID BLUE – ON – OSD AUDIO SOUNDSOLE 2.1 is ON. SINGLE BLUE FLASH - Confirms receiving an IR command from the OSD AUDIO SOUNDSOLE 2.1 Remote for changes to Treble/Bass, EQ Reset, Simulated Surround (SR), single Volume UP/DOWN command, initiating output of the Bluetooth Connection Code. RAPID BLUE FLASH - Confirms receiving a continuous IR stream from the SOUNDSOLE 2.1 Remote for ramping volume UP/DOWN. Rapid blue flash also indicates the SOUNDSOLE 2.1 is in Bluetooth pairing mode. SLOW BLUE FLASH - Audio Mute. Audio signal to the speakers is turned OFF. TWO BLUE FLASHES; DELAY - Bluetooth input is selected and no Bluetooth device is connected or it is out of range. 2. IR SENSOR - (Behind front panel lens.) The IR Sensor ‘sees’ the IR control commands output from the SOUNDSOLE 2.1 IR Remote Control when buttons are pressed on the remote for armchair control of the SOUNDSOLE 2.1. This sensor must be unobstructed for direct line-of-sight to the remote, or the remote will not be able to control the SOUNDSOLE 2.1. 1 2 Page 5 OSD Audio · 775 Columbia Street · Brea, CA 92821 · Tel: (562) 697-2600 · www.osdaudio.com DIGITAL FIBER OPTIC INPUT - One Digital Fiber Optic port. DOWN FIRING SUBWOOFER - The OSD AUDIO SOUNDSOLE 2.1 bottom panel features two 5-1/4” subwoofers, one of the Drivers is active driven by a 30 Watt Low Pass Digital Class D Amplifier. The second 5.25” driver is a Passive radiator helping to tune the enclosure. When handling the SOUNDSOLE 2.1 be careful not to grab or hold the cabinet bottom where the woofers are located to prevent damaging the woofers. Also take care to not set the cabinet down on anything but a flat surface clear of obstructions. When placing the OSD AUDIO SOUNDSOLE 2.1 PLATFORM on a shelf or stand, be sure there are no objects under the cabinet that will damage or block the woofers and check to make sure there are no objects on the sides of the cabinet that will block the space under the SOUNDSOLE 2.1. Blocking this space will reduce overall bass performance. 3.5MM AUX STEREO AUDIO INPUT – A Single 3.5mm Stereo; Connect to the Headphone Jack of any iPod, iPad, Laptop or PC computer. POWER - Press this button to turn the SOUNDSOLE 2.1 ON/OFF. 2. SRC; SOURCE- Press to select a connected source. The SOUNDSOLE 2.1 Front Panel Status LED will flash once to indicate a change in input selection. LINE IN1, AUX – 3.5mm input, from Headphone Jack ANALOG connection LINE IN2, RCA – Left and Right Signal Level Stereo RCA Input, ANALOG. Optical LINE IN – Digital Fiber Optic Input 3. VOLUME -/+ Press VOL (-) to reduce volume. Press VOL (+) to increase volume. 4. DSP Effect – Advanced Digital Signal Processing which creates simulated surround sound from a stereo speaker configuration. This will dramatically open up the sound stage making the appear to be coming from all over the room. There are two choices for DSP settings. Typically you would use the Cinematic setting when watching a Video, Movie or Television show.
